Understanding AI-Driven Blueprint Generation for Landscaping
AI-driven blueprint generation is transforming the landscape design industry by revolutionizing the way we approach landscaping projects. This technology leverages advanced algorithms to create detailed, precise plans for various outdoor spaces, including hardscaping features like stonework. By automating the initial design phase, AI offers numerous benefits, such as reduced human error, faster project turnaround times, and optimized time and material estimation for stonework.
Using machine learning and computer vision, AI systems can analyze existing landscapes, understand spatial relationships, and generate blueprints that seamlessly integrate with surrounding environments. Moreover, these tools account for factors like terrain elevation, sunlight exposure, and local climate conditions to ensure the longevity and aesthetic appeal of the final hardscape design. This level of customization and efficiency is particularly advantageous for both residential and commercial landscaping projects.
The Role of AI in Time and Material Estimation for Stonework
Artificial Intelligence (AI) is transforming the landscape architecture industry, particularly in streamlining processes that were once manual and time-consuming. One significant area where AI excels is in the domain of AI time and material estimation for stonework. By leveraging machine learning algorithms and vast datasets, AI models can accurately predict the required materials and labor for intricate stonework projects. This capability not only enhances efficiency but also ensures cost-effectiveness.
The process involves inputting project blueprints and specifications into the AI system, which then analyzes historical data on similar stonework installations. Through this analysis, the AI can identify patterns, standard quantities of materials used, and optimal labor allocation. This intelligent approach minimizes errors, reduces waste, and allows for more precise budgeting, ultimately streamlining the construction timeline.
